Aunty my only question about the Vyapar marriages of BC. If all marriages were Vyapar, how was one going to be on an elevated, and higher moral and ethical plane? Why should always Bharath Ma voice overs have a definite agenda and try to din in a present non-existent soul to soul connection?

It may grow and develop in slow stages like a tree from its sapling stage to its fruit bearing stage. But now when it is not even in consideration, why denigrate other relationships formed by Chandra with other women in blanket terms? Another thing I really really hate is how Bharath Ma sits in judgement over Helena and Nandini.

How is one better than the other? One is delusional and ready to believe everything her father says and does in an unquestioning manner(we clearly know how wrong Nand is) without taking any definite and decisive stand, and is ready to completely ignore, or at least be persuaded to ignore a very serious allegation on her would be husband like attempt to rape on another woman (Daasi), and sweep it under the carpet until the same thing happens to her.

The other lady is narcissistic and thinks only about herself and her priorities first. So in what way is one woman more perfect than the other? Both of them are flawed! So why praise one at the expense of the other?

@shailaja, i think the only real difference between nandini and helena right now is that whilst helena's defining quality may be selfish, nandini's is that shes an extremely careless human being. helena would kill someone without blinking if that served her purpose, but nandini would kill someone without meaning to and then move on with a- oh dear! it was an accident. whilst one kills with an aim, the other one is much more dangerous cos her actions are indiscriminate. i wouldnt credit nandini with ignorance. she knew what happened with that dasi, but she decides to ignore it because it may potentially distraught people she's close too. or worse, not bother them. nand wouldnt care if malay harassed a dasi, it would be 'locker room talk' and a pat on the back. nandini doesnt want to see that truth. as long as she doesnt see the truth she can remain ignorant and people suffer as a consequence. she cant feel beyond her limited perception because she chooses to not see cos its tougher. the belle gaston situation between her and malay is just annoying. and the reason bharat mata advocates for her rather than helena is because of two elements- the obvious- foreign vs homegrown feel good factor- nandini is a better person cos shes a hindustani girl with hindustani morals which are superior. it makes the audience feel good about themselves and their hindustani morals over the treacherous foreigner. second is as i said, we are conditioned to believe that being a woman our LAST duty is to ourselves- parents, spouse, children, siblings- everyone comes before we do on our own priority list. and anything else is being selfish which we are made to believe is the worst thing to be, whereas being careless, being ignorant and inaction in filial compulsion are all fine and even revered at times. a girl crying cos she made daddy a commitment and now he wont let her off the hook is a lot easier to understand than a girl intent on taking revenge for the wound a man made on her body and soul.
